Wisdom of boys: Why God likes them better
I was walking on the schoolyard with a 7-year-old friend today when he slipped his backpack on backward, giving himself a great round belly full of books.
“Look,” he said, patting his protuberance. “It’s the new fashion.”
Then I decided to pick his little brain for blog fodder:
“That way you can see what it feels like to be pregnant,” I said with a grin, motioning to a pregnant mom across the lawn.
Belly Boy: “That’s just for girls.”
“I know. We’re lucky,” I said, leading him a little closer to the edge.
BB: “No, we’re lucky. We don’t have to worry about that stuff.”
Me: “Yeah, guys just have to sit around and act worried.”
BB: “… and worry about whether the baby’s a girl or not.”
That boy is wise beyond his years.
